Program the modem. Depending on the modem used, the commands to program the modem parameters may be
different. Table 8-2 lists the modem parameters and the associated commands according to two of the more widely
used modems, Hayes AT and US Robotics. For programming information about other modems, refer to the
associated documentation.
Write the commands to the modem NVRAM. This is usually done using the AT&W command. (Refer to your
modem documentation for further instructions.)

With the CSMIM2 in the Admin Mode, enter the commands (example is for port 16):
port 16
show port
The port parameters are displayed. In this example, it is the port 16 parameters.
Check for the following:
- Autobaud is set to N.
- Port speed is set as high as possible. The highest port speed is dependent on the modem (refer to the modem manual for
the maximum speed) and the CSMIM software revision. For MicroCS, MODMIM, and CSMIM2 with rev. 8.1.1, the
maximum speed is 57600 bps; with rev. 9.0 or greater, the maximum speed is 115200 bps. The CSMIM maximum speed
is hardware set to 38400 bps and the CSMIM-T1 maximum speed is 115200.
It is recommended that you set the CSMIM2 to its maximum port speed and then set the modem speed accordingly. Set the
DTE line of the modem so that it runs at a fixed rate.

Table 8-2. Modem Settings for High Speed (V.32, V.42) Type Links
Parameters Hayes AT US Robotics
CTS/RTS (hardware) flow control &K3 &R2&H1
Hang up, disconnect, and reset on loss of DTR &D3 &D2
DCD following Carrier Detect &C1 &C1
DSR always forced on &S0 &S0
Echo Commands E1 E1
Numeric result codes V0 V0
Result codes on originated calls only Q2 Q2
Auto answer on S0=1 S0=1
V.42 bis compression S46=138 &B1&K2
V.42 error correction &Q9
Dial time-out of 60 seconds S7=60 S7=60
